About
Hi my name is Aliana, I’m an Ivy League graduate with 5+ years of tutoring experience. I attended the University of Pennsylvania for my BA in International Relations and French Studies and University College London for my Master’s degree in Political Science.
I began tutoring English, Literature, History, Spanish, and French while in graduate school in London. I mostly worked with high school students, including some who were undertaking a US-focused curriculum. I worked with my students to align their skillset with what was demanded from them by their curriculum. I did my best to make each lesson accessible and approachable by tailoring our sessions to each student’s needs.
I also prepared students to take the ACT and SAT. I worked with students who planned to attend a US university and helped them devise a study schedule and plan. Based on my skillset, most of my students requested help with the Reading and Writing test sections. I also tutored Math to a lesser extent. I did my best to bolster not just my students’ test preparation but also their confidence. As such, many of my former students gained admission to their number one choice of school and felt prepared to undertake a new and challenging curriculum as a university student.
What I love most about tutoring is the ability to help a student truly understand something that they have been struggling with. I hope my passion for the arts, particularly English and History, come across in each lesson. I create a lesson plan for each session tailored to the individual student and I work carefully to best accommodate their needs. I pay close attention to how a student best learns and shape my lessons accordingly. I tutor one-on-one, largely remote, so each student has my full attention. I typically work with high school students but have had former clients in middle school and in university.
